What does a Director of Regulatory Affairs do?
A Director of Regulatory Affairs ensures that a company's products comply with all regulations and laws pertinent to the product. They also develop and implement strategies and plans for regulatory affairs and oversee their execution.

What skills are needed for a Director of Regulatory Affairs?
A Director of Regulatory Affairs should have strong communication skills, attention to detail, understanding of scientific, law, and business knowledge, and good leadership abilities.
What qualifications are needed for a Director of Regulatory Affairs?
In general, a bachelor's degree in prelaw, engineering, or related fields is required. However, many successful Directors of Regulatory Affairs hold advanced degrees in science or law.
